French Band Masala Dosa MUMBAI: French band Masala Dosa wrapped up the promotional tour of their new album Electro World Curry... across India recently after playing at various venues in Mumbai, Goa, Pune, Bengalaru, Hyderabad, Pushkar, Chandigarh, Madras and Delhi. The three member band comprises Pierre Jean Duffour, who plays the sitar, his brother Brice Duffour - the bass guitarist and Franck Lemoine, the band's drummer and their close friend from childhood. ...

MUMBAI: Journalists from across all services of the BBC have resolved to hold two one-day strikes in April, prompted by plans to "offshore" operations for the BBC World Service's Hindi, Nepali, and Urdu programming to Delhi, Kathmandu, and Islamabad  Reports in the Guardian say that TV, radio and online news will be disrupted on 3 April and 9 April, after nearly 800 members of the National Union of Journalists chapel at the BBC voted in favour of industrial action in a national ballot on Tuesday. ...

Singer Kylie Minogue MUMBAI: Now it can be told. Singer Kylie Minogue, who made a whirlwind tour to India last fortnight, has recorded a bhangra-pop number written by Abbas Tyrewala and composed by A R Rahman. Kylie, during her stay, recorded two songs for Blue - a duet with Sonu Niigaam and a dance number. The film's music scored has been done by none other than Academy award winner A R Rahman. ...

MUMBAI: As the Kolkata Station of BIG 92.7 FM delivers on its offerings of Moner Moto Gaan (music that you like!) each day, the Station has begun on a very innovative way to reach out to more and more people of Kolkata. Saturday's mornings see RJ Koushik host the breakfast show, the BIG Chumuk, live from the quintessential Kolkata Bazzars as he interacts with public who come for the traditional Saturday morning weekly shopping. Interactions take exciting twists as people share insights into their lives and fascinating gossip which makes for interesting on air content. ...
